Avoiding Fly Tippers - All garden clearance professionals in Swansea, Wales, have to hold a relevant license to say that they're legally allowed to tip your waste. Ask them if they've got a "waste carrier, broker or dealer" licence, this is a permit issued by the UK government allowing them to dispose of waste on the behalf of others (ie not their own). Using their business name or registration number you can check on the internet to find out if they are registered. You can check if they are registered HERE. If they don't have one of these licences they'll likely be fly tipping your waste which could lead to YOU being punished.

If you want to avoid encouraging mice, flies, rats and other pests into your garden, you should not allow mixed waste and rubbish to build up there. These pests love heaps of garbage in which they can make their homes and breed.

A fact that you might not be aware of is that most local councils provide either a paid or free collection service for garden waste, and by placing it into the bins provided (usually green or brown), they'll pick it up and take it away on a regular weekly or fortnightly basis throughout most of the year. As even the paid-for services are pretty reasonable, this may be worth considering, especially if you generate lots of garden waste and this process enables you to dispose of your green waste gradually over the months.

Building Waste Removal in Swansea

A vital part of any construction or renovation project is the correct disposal of waste materials, which helps to maintain a clean and organized worksite while minimizing environmental impacts. Incorrectly disposing of building waste can result in environmental contamination, public health risks, and legal complications. To ensure proper waste management, a comprehensive removal strategy must be put in place.

The first step in building waste removal is to identify the types of waste that will be generated during the project. This involves various materials, including metal, wood, bricks and concrete, as well as dangerous substances like lead and asbestos. Once these materials have been identified, a waste management plan can be developed.

Details such as the volume and type of waste to be generated, in addition to the steps for collection, transport, and disposal, should be included in the waste management plan. It should also include information on reuse and recycling opportunities for the waste materials, as this can help to reduce the environmental impact of the project.

A reputable waste disposal service is a key factor in ensuring the effective implementation of the waste management plan. They possess the ability to suggest the most fitting waste removal and disposal procedures, while at the same time ensuring that they adhere to all legal and regulatory mandates.

To summarise, the removal of building waste is a crucial aspect of the construction industry. By designing a waste management program and working alongside a reputable waste removal provider, it's achievable to properly dispose of waste materials and decrease the ecological footprint of home improvement and construction projects.

Garden Levelling and Grading

Creating a smooth and even surface in your garden, garden levelling and grading is a crucial component of landscaping. Facilitating better drainage, preventing water pooling, and establishing a solid foundation, this process enables diverse outdoor activities.

The specialist during garden levelling conducts a thorough assessment of the terrain and identifies the areas in need of adjustment. The removal of excess soil or filling of low spots can be accomplished by them using tools such as shovels, rakes, or heavy machinery. They ensure the ground is level and uniform through the redistribution of the soil.

Focusing on the overall contour and incline of the garden, grading plays a significant role. It involves shaping the land to direct water flow away from structures and towards appropriate drainage areas. This safeguards your garden from water damage and erosion, ensuring its safety and proper maintenance.

By undertaking professional garden levelling and grading, you can greatly improve the aesthetic appeal and functionality of your outside space. It guarantees the stability and levelness of landscaping features, including paths, patios and plant beds, by providing a solid base. Properly levelling and grading your garden allows you to create an environment that is both visually pleasing and practical for all your outside activities.

What's more, a garden that is properly levelled and graded ensures adequate water distribution, prevents waterlogged areas, and promotes healthy plant growth, leading to a vibrant and thriving garden landscape.

Garden Shed Removal/Dismantling Swansea

When your garden shed has reached the end of its working life it can be something of a challenge to take it down and remove it before a replacement is built. You can rely on a garden clearance specialist in Swansea to do all the hard graft for you, by organising the shed's removal and transportation to a recycling centre or an approved waste disposal facility. It might even be feasible for others to repair or reuse all or some of the parts, if the shed is in a useable condition. In circumstances like this, the garden clearance company will take more care in taking your shed apart, and arrange for it to be moved to its new home. Once the framework has been successfully dismantled, the exposed area can be cleaned and readied for your next project, or the foundations restored if you're replacing it with a new shed.
